Why are Southwest flights delayed?

Written by Sarah Marsh — 0 Views
Southwest Airlines has canceled 9,400 flights in past six weeks, and more are on way. The nation's largest domestic carrier blamed the unprecedented flight cancellations on a trio of problems: winter weather, a high-profile labor dispute with its mechanics' union and the recent FAA grounding of the Boeing 737 Max 8.

Does Southwest have cancellation fees?

There are no fees to cancel a Southwest flight. If you paid for the flight with Rapid Rewards points, they will be automatically redeposited into your account. If you purchased a Wanna Get Away fare with cash, the money will be held as a reusable travel fund to be applied towards the purchase of a future flight.

Can airlines cancel flights if not full?

So yes, they may cancel a flight because there are too few passengers on it, but not JUST because there are too few passengers. If there are habitually too few passengers they will adjust the schedule and permanently cancel that flight.

Why is Southwest so cheap?

Fuel Costs: Southwest has been aggressively hedging its fuel costs. This means they are able to keep ticket prices stable during oil price spikes, while other airlines have to pass the costs through to customers.

What is the difference between Southwest anytime and wanna get away?

Anytime – This is Southwest's fully refundable “Y” fare. Wanna Get Away – These are non-refundable fares, and encompass all of the fare buckets that aren't business select, or full-fare “Y” refundable tickets. Wanna Get Away is by no means a basic economy fare.

How far out can you book a Southwest flight?

When does Southwest open up new fares for booking? Most airlines allow you to book tickets 330 days ahead of time, but Southwest generally only allows bookings between 90 and 180 days in advance.
